@dellr48 @freddyJ620 I’m part of the Pre-Nursing Society at Stony Brook, and at the meeting we had the other week, someone voiced the same concern to the School of Nursing admissions coordinator. She’s completely aware that opportunities to volunteer are very slim for the time being, and said not volunteering won’t hurt your chances of getting in. She also said that students have been accepted with no medical experience in past years. So as long as your cumulative and pre-requisite GPAs are good first and foremost, you don’t need to worry. ?
